Current market prices

TCGplayer market$3.45
Cardmarket low€3.20 (~$3.69)
TCGplayer mid$3.67
PSA 10 (eBay median)-

Buy / comps: TCGplayer · eBay sold · Cardmarket

Sale price history

Stable near $3.45 across 38 days on record.

Braixen #TG01 is a standout card from the Silver Tempest set, representing the Trainer Gallery Rare Holo category. This card, illustrated by the talented Naoki Saito, features vibrant artwork that showcases Braixen in a captivating pose, making it a favorite among fans and collectors alike. As a Trainer Gallery card, it holds a special place in the Pokémon Trading Card Game, often sought after for its unique design and limited availability. Collectors are particularly drawn to its rarity and the artistic flair that Naoki Saito brings to the Pokémon universe. Grading and Its Impact on Value

Grading plays a crucial role in determining the value of Braixen #TG01. Cards that are professionally graded tend to command higher prices due to the assurance of their condition and authenticity. Grading services evaluate cards based on criteria such as centering, surface quality, and edges, which can significantly affect a card's appeal to collectors. A well-graded Braixen can stand out in the market, leading to increased interest and potential offers. Collectors should consider having their cards graded to enhance their value, but it's important to weigh the costs of grading against the potential increase in worth.
